Am Fr 28. März 2008 schrieb Andy Green: GSM not only holds information on recent "active" (booked in) cell, but also for next 6 (or 8?) next best cells, to handle cell handover. Each of these cells with same info (signal, channel...) like active cell.
And then there is time advance too. It tells in increments of 180m (IIRC) the distance of MS to BS. (Used to calibrate MS to fit nicely in the time division multiplex at BS receiver) Anyway it is not (yet) clear whether we may get this info from GSM modem (just received the data sheets, pfff: 15meg!)
